Why mouth-to-mouth resuscitation and emergency treatment job differently for little bodies
Children are not merely smaller adults. They dehydrate quicker. Their respiratory tracts are narrower. Their heart issues, unless there is a recognized problem, usually start as breathing problems. That means emergency treatment and CPR Cannon Hill parents learn must mirror pediatric priorities.
With infants, your fingers do the compressions due to the fact that the upper body wall is adaptable. The proportion of compressions to breaths is frequently 30 to 2 for a single rescuer, 15 to 2 if 2 rescuers are present. For the preschooler who chokes, back blows are angled and company, with the head lower than the upper body. You will certainly see instructors show how to sustain the jaw without squeezing the soft cells of the throat. The contrast with grown-up methods becomes clear the very first time you listen to a kid's cough tighten up during method scenarios. Method is not about compliance, it is about physics and anatomy.
Burns are an additional location where information matter. I still see ice used on youngsters's burns. Ice raises cells damage and distracts from the real treatment: great running water for at least 20 mins. A great cpr and emergency treatment program Cannon Hillside facilitators run will certainly drill that number right into muscle memory and talk about the exemptions, such as infants or when hypothermia is a threat since the youngster is small and the area is cold.

Deciding when to call an ambulance
Most childhood years events solve with emergency treatment. A knocked tooth can wait on the dental professional, a scratched arm joint requires cleaning and a cuddle. The grey zone is where doubt expands. Training assists you recognize patterns that warrant a 000 phone call without embarassment concerning overreacting.
Severe breathing problem, altered awareness, unchecked blood loss, believed back injury after a fall from elevation, an allergy with voice modifications or salivating, a seizure lasting more than 5 mins or recurring, or any kind of infant under 3 months with a high temperature that makes them saggy. These are not academic. I have actually stood in Cannon Hill kitchens during 2 of them, and both times early calls led to smooth care. Emergency treatment and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ation Cannon Hillside groups need to also know the regional health center paths and the normal rescue feedback times. You do not require precise numbers, just the sense that aid is on the method and your work is to maintain the kid stable and comforted until it arrives.
Allergies and asthma, the repeat visitors
In childcare, anaphylaxis and asthma are not uncommon occasions. Where there are children, there are peanut crumbs, bee stings, dirt, and lawn. The primary step is avoidance, which stays in regular. Check out activity plans. Shop EpiPens and spacers where every person can reach them. Revolve stock so expiry days do not sneak past. After that practice.
In a sensible mouth-to-mouth resuscitation and first aid cannon hillside session, ask to run a full allergic reaction drill: acknowledging hives or facial swelling, determining whether to provide adrenaline, using the device properly, after that keeping track of and preparing for a obtaining first aid certification 2nd dosage if signs do not improve. Individuals obtain anxious about providing adrenaline. Fitness instructors ought to describe that an unneeded dosage is usually much less harmful than a delayed required one. With asthma, the dosage for reducer medication with a spacer is determined in puffs with rests between, not a mad rush to clear the cylinder. Method, once again, defeats bravado.

Building an easy childcare emergency treatment setup at home
Parents typically request a shopping list after a training course. You do not require a travel suitcase of gear, yet a deliberate package beats a lightweight box stuffed with expired sachets. Keep a portable package in the car and a larger one in the kitchen. Store a second pair of handwear covers with the extra EpiPen. Label racks so anybody childcare can locate things.
Here is a lean home setup that covers the typical events.
- Clean wound clean or clean and sterile saline, non-stick pads, crepe bandage, sticky tape. A lot of scrapes are handled with gentle cleaning, a completely dry pad, and pressure. Digital thermostat, children's paracetamol or ibuprofen dosed by weight, a little notebook. Writing down the time and dose helps if you require to talk with a registered nurse later. Instant cold packs, yet focus on recyclable fabrics and water. For contusions and bumps, cloth-wrapped cold for 10 to 20 mins reduces swelling without narrowing vessels too much. Ventolin with a spacer sized for your child if recommended, and any kind of suggested adrenaline auto-injector. Shop with clear instructions taped to the box. A portable light and tweezers for splinters, especially after play ground adventures.

Real tales, actual lessons
At a Cannon Hill after-school program, a nine-year-old took a round to the face and had a nosebleed that would certainly not give up. New staff moved toward panic up until an elderly teacher anchored the group. Gloves on, chin tucked slightly down, pressure used without packing tissues right into the nostril, silence for a full ten mins as opposed to looking every thirty seconds. The blood loss reduced, the kid cracked a joke concerning vampire movies, and the team breathed out. The only distinction was holding the line on proper stress and time.
A family I worked with on Keats Road had a toddler who chewed happily, after that went quiet. The father identified the tranquility for what it was: airway obstruction. He delivered 5 back blows with the child facedown over his forearm, inspected, after that followed with breast thrusts. A grape portion displaced. He cried later on, in relief and anxiety. His training offered him movement when most individuals ice up. That is the deal training offers. You still really feel whatever, yet your hands recognize where to go.
